Beaumont Water Bill Login: Account Number Not Recognized
Beaumont’s new payment provider FAQ gives a very specific fix for account number problems. It says account numbers are case sensitive and users should try again using no preceding zeros but using the dash.
Check this before you call
- Use the newest bill, not an old bill from a previous account or old property.
- Do not add preceding zeros if the system rejects the number.
- Keep the dash in the account number.
- Match upper/lowercase if any letter appears in the account details.
- Make sure the service address belongs to your Beaumont property.
- Check pending payments before submitting another payment.

Start New Water Service in Beaumont TX
The official New Water Service Application is the correct starting point when you need to establish a new City of Beaumont water account. The form states that at least one working day notice is required to connect service.
New service item |
Official detail |
Practical note |
|---|---|---|
Application |
Submit early. Do not wait until the day you need water turned on. |
|
Notice required |
Minimum one working day notice to connect service |
Apply before your move-in date, especially before weekends or holidays. |
Deposit |
Not less than $125 mandatory deposit |
Confirm final deposit amount before submitting or visiting. |
Service fee |
$20 service fee due when setting up new service |
Budget for the deposit plus the service fee. |
Running water at meter |
City will not initiate service if the meter indicates water is running |
Check faucets, toilets and valves before requesting service activation. |
Beaumont Water Bill Payment Options
The City FAQ says Beaumont offers several ways to pay a utility bill: online, in person at City Hall, by mail, or by auto draft through your bank. Choose the method based on how urgent the payment is.
Payment method |
Best use |
Important caution |
|---|---|---|
Online payment |
Fast payment, payment history, pending payment check, account status and balance review. |
Use the correct account number format and save confirmation. |
In person at City Hall |
Account confusion, urgent payment, customer support or proof-based questions. |
Bring your bill, account number, ID and payment proof if you already paid. |
Mail payment |
Non-urgent payment when there is enough time before the due date. |
Mail may not arrive in time if the account is already late. |
Bank auto draft |
Customers who want to reduce missed payments. |
Confirm setup, bank account changes and first draft timing with the City or your bank. |
Estimated Beaumont Water Bill: What If It Was Too High?
Beaumont’s Finance Water Billing FAQ says an estimated bill caused by flooding will be adjusted during the next billing cycle when actual usage is recorded. If the customer was billed more than actual usage, the balance is credited on the next month’s water bill.
-
Compare the estimated bill with your next actual bill.
Look for a credit or adjustment once actual usage is recorded. -
Check payment history online.
The online system can show payment and billing history, including pending payments. -
Call Water Billing if the adjustment does not appear.
Use 409-866-0023 and have both bills ready. -
Keep photos or meter readings if available.
If a weather event or flooding affected reading access, documentation may help your conversation.

Beaumont TX Water Bill FAQs
How do I pay my Beaumont TX water bill online?
Open the official City of Beaumont Water Billing page and select Pay Water Bill Online. The online system can show payment history, pending payments, account status, balance, last bill sent and billing history.
What is the Beaumont Water Billing phone number?
Call Water Billing at 409-866-0023 for statement amount, missing bill, balance and water billing questions.
Where can I pay my Beaumont water bill in person?
The City FAQ says utility bills can be paid in person at City Hall, 801 Main St. The City Pay page also lists 801 Main, Suite 210, Beaumont, TX 77701.
Why is the Beaumont payment system not recognizing my account number?
The City payment provider FAQ says account numbers are case sensitive. Try using no preceding zeros, but keep the dash. If it still does not work, call Paya support at 877-589-9210 Monday through Friday, 8 AM to 5 PM CST.
How do I start water service in Beaumont TX?
Use the official New Water Service Application. The application says the City requires at least one working day notice to connect service.
How much is the Beaumont new water service deposit?
The official New Water Service Application says a deposit of not less than $125 is mandatory to establish a new account, and a $20 service fee is also due when setting up service.
What should I do if I did not receive my Beaumont water bill?
The City Finance page says utility statements are mailed monthly. If you do not receive a statement, call Water Billing at 409-866-0023 for the statement amount or check your balance online.
Can Beaumont disconnect water service for late payment?
The City Finance page says payments must be received on time to avoid disconnection of service and that service charges are assessed on late payments.
What happens if my Beaumont water bill was estimated too high?
The City Finance Water Billing FAQ says an estimated bill that was larger than actual usage will be adjusted during the next billing cycle when actual usage is recorded, and a credit will appear on the next month’s bill if applicable.
Can I set up auto draft for my Beaumont water bill?
The City FAQ says customers can set up auto draft through their bank. Confirm the current process with your bank and the City before relying on the first automatic payment.
Why is my Beaumont water bill high?
Common causes include running toilets, outdoor leaks, irrigation, estimated billing, flooding-related meter access, payment posting issues, property vacancy or water running during new service activation.
